Royal Caribbean is on the brink of a transformational journey as it prepares for extensive renovations of three of its flagship vessels—Ovation of the Seas, Harmony of the Seas, and Liberty of the Seas. Slated for 2026, these upgrades are part of the Royal Amplified program, designed to significantly elevate the guest experience and introduce a host of new features throughout the ships. Following the successful transformation of Allure of the Seas, these enhancements promise to set a new standard for Royal Caribbean’s fleet, ensuring that guests enjoy unforgettable and innovative vacation experiences.
In addition to the exciting ship updates, Royal Caribbean is expanding its horizons by introducing four new destination experiences, with the highly anticipated debut of Perfect Day Mexico in 2027. This new addition will diversify the cruise line’s collection of unique ports of call, solidifying Royal Caribbean’s commitment to providing travelers with memorable adventures.
Ovation of the Seas: A Major Overhaul
The Ovation of the Seas is poised for a major overhaul, particularly in its outdoor spaces. Guests can look forward to a redesigned pool deck featuring private cabanas and a brand-new whirlpool, creating an exclusive and tranquil area for relaxation. Dining experiences aboard the ship will also see significant improvements, highlighted by the introduction of Giovanni’s Italian Kitchen, where guests can indulge in classic Italian cuisine, and Izumi Teppanyaki, offering an interactive hibachi dining experience that promises to engage the senses.
Adding to the vibrant atmosphere, the Ovation will feature the Pesky Parrot tiki bar, a lively venue for enjoying tropical cocktails and drinks. The entertainment options are equally thrilling, with the introduction of Sound Cellar, a dynamic venue for dancing and live music performances. For gaming enthusiasts, the expanded Casino Royale will provide more options and excitement, making it a central hub of onboard activity.
Adventure seekers will not be disappointed, as the Ripcord by iFly skydiving simulator will offer an adrenaline-pumping experience, while the SeaPlex—the largest indoor activity space at sea—will cater to guests of all ages with a variety of fun activities. Starting in spring 2026, Ovation of the Seas will embark on seven- to thirteen-night Alaskan voyages, providing travelers with breathtaking views of Alaska’s stunning landscapes and diverse wildlife.

Harmony of the Seas: Caribbean Inspirations
Harmony of the Seas is also set to undergo exciting enhancements, particularly in its pool deck area. A Caribbean-inspired makeover will introduce The Lime & Coconut bar, a laid-back spot perfect for sipping tropical drinks while basking in the sun. The adults-only Solarium will receive a thoughtful redesign, creating a serene oasis for relaxation and rejuvenation.
Dining aboard Harmony will boast over 20 dining venues, ensuring a culinary adventure for every palate. New offerings include Playmakers Sports Bar & Arcade, where guests can catch live sports events while enjoying delicious bar food, and El Loco Fresh, serving up vibrant Mexican dishes that delight the senses. The Samba Grill Brazilian Steakhouse will be another exciting addition, allowing guests to savor a traditional churrasco dining experience filled with sizzling meats and flavorful sides.
After a summer 2026 season in Europe, Harmony of the Seas will make its way to Port Canaveral, Florida, for its winter sailings. Beginning late 2026, the ship will offer Caribbean cruises with five- and seven-night itineraries, visiting beautiful destinations such as Charlotte Amalie in St. Thomas, Falmouth in Jamaica, and Perfect Day at CocoCay in The Bahamas. Moreover, guests will gain exclusive access to the Royal Beach Club Paradise Island, set to open in December 2025, further enhancing their vacation experience.

Liberty of the Seas: A Comprehensive Redesign
Liberty of the Seas is slated for an extensive redesign, including a revamped pool deck featuring The Lime & Coconut bar, private cabanas, and the exciting new Royal Escape Room. This immersive experience will challenge guests to solve puzzles and escape within a time limit, providing a thrilling adventure for families and friends alike. For those with a passion for dining, Liberty of the Seas will introduce Izumi Teppanyaki, showcasing flavorful Japanese cuisine, along with a brand-new Starbucks, perfect for coffee lovers seeking a caffeine fix.
The ship will set sail from Southampton in the summer of 2026, embarking on a series of seven-night European itineraries. These cruises will transport guests to breathtaking locations, including the Norwegian fjords, the enchanting city of Bruges in Belgium, and the historic capital of Copenhagen in Denmark.
